Strawberry Cream Cheese Muffins

Moist and fluffy strawberry cream cheese muffins, perfect for breakfast or a sweet snack, bursting with fresh strawberries and a creamy filling.

Ingredients

Scale
  • 2 cups all-purpose flour
  • 1/2 cup granulated sugar
  • 2 tsp baking powder
  • 1/2 tsp baking soda
  • 1/4 tsp salt
  • 1/2 cup unsalted butter, melted
  • 1 cup buttermilk
  • 2 large eggs
  • 1 tsp vanilla extract
  • 1 1/2 cups fresh strawberries, chopped
  • 4 oz cream cheese, softened
  • 2 tbsp powdered sugar

Instructions

  1. Preheat the oven to 375°F (190°C) and line a muffin tin with paper liners.
  2. In a large bowl, whisk together flour, sugar, baking powder, baking soda, and salt.
  3. In another bowl, combine melted butter, buttermilk, eggs, and vanilla extract.
  4. Pour the wet ingredients into the dry ingredients and stir until just combined.
  5. Gently fold in chopped strawberries, being careful not to overmix.
  6. In a small bowl, mix cream cheese and powdered sugar until smooth.
  7. Spoon a tablespoon of muffin batter into each liner, add a small dollop of cream cheese mixture in the center, then cover with more batter.
  8. Bake for 20-25 minutes or until a toothpick inserted comes out clean.
  9. Let muffins cool in the tin for 5 minutes, then transfer to a wire rack to cool completely.

Notes

For extra flavor, sprinkle the tops with a little coarse sugar before baking or add a drizzle of strawberry glaze when cooled.
